**BASIC FUNCTION**: Under mínimal supervision, the Unhoused Youth Program Manager facilitates the collaboration between District unhoused youth, families, case managers, school site staff, shelters, social services, special education, student services, mentors, tutors, community organizations, and government agencies to ensure the physical, social/emotional, and educational needs of the unhoused youth attending Oakland Unified schools are being met. The Program Manager promotes and supports the OUSD Strategic Plan to create equitable opportunities for learning and success to ensure all students are college and career ready and plays an integral role in achieving the mission and goals of a Full Service Community District by providing support to students and families.

**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S**:
***

***:

- Supervise McKinney-Vento program staff to ensure that services and entitlements for unhoused youth are accessible and efficacious to meet the academic, social and emotional learning needs of students in OUSD.****:

- Facilitate and expedite the enrollment of unhoused youth and families into OUSD schools.****:

- Advocate for students’ educational needs by creating a continuum of care between schools, shelters, public assistance agencies, employment, health, and other social service agencies.****:

- Lead professional development for unhoused youth case managers and contractual providers to instill the knowledge and skills necessary to effectively support unhoused youth and families to achieve success academically, socially and emotionally.****:

- Facilitate the delivery of timely, accurate, accessible, and language-specific information to unhoused parents, caregivers, and service providers about unhoused youth services and entitlements and serve as an educational advocate to qualifying students.****:

- Manage outreach to schools, transitional housing, shelters, encampments, child welfare and juvenile justice placements, and other residences in support unhoused youth and families.****:

- Develop and manage systems and protocols that assist unhoused youth with transitions into a public school setting; collaborate in the development of assessments, strategies, defining goals, preparing action plans, and accessing information and resources.****:

- Ensure the successful enrollment and re-entry of unhoused youth by serving as a liaison between students, families and the OUSD student enrollment office.****:

- Support unaccompanied and unhoused youth to access a continuum of educational and community-based services and supports to facilitate employment, post-secondary school and career readiness.****:

- Oversee and monitor attendance and discipline reports of unhoused youth and families in OUSD and provide case management to meet academic, social and emotional needs.****:

- Coordinate with administrators, staff, and student service providers to ensure access to a continuum of supports for unhoused youth and families.****:

- Facilitate access to health education and parent education programs for unhoused youth and families, and their caregivers.****:

- Maintain database of unhoused youth and families to document case plan including identified needs, services brokered, services rendered, and their associated impact and outcomes.****:

- Ensure that all OUSD unhoused youth providers develop and maintain caring and equitable relationships with students, parents, staff, and service providers to ensure open and ongoing communication and collaboration in support of student’s needs.****:

- Work in partnership with the Behavioral Health Unit, Student Assignment Center, Attendance and Discipline Support Services, Programs for Exceptional Children, and the Family Engagement unit to ensure access to an array of services for delinquent and unhoused youth and families and their families.****:

- Coordinate partnerships to ensure that unhoused youth access available transition services such as vocational training, emancipation services and training for independent living.****:
